Transaction 103c03c3eeae325eeb1dba7ad32ffae298ebb4f6686ef243abe115907591a1b0
1 Input
1 Output
-
103c03c3eeae325eeb1dba7ad32ffae298ebb4f6686ef243abe115907591a1b0:0
- value
- 38068659
- script pubkey
- OP_0 OP_PUSHBYTES_20 abe0b31f77dd0d5ce841d890c3b446a8bbf14959
- address
- bc1q40stx8mhm5x4e6zpmzgv8dzx4zalzj2epc0cyu